最近 Nvidia440.31ドライバーの新しい安定したブランチが一般にリリースされました。 そのバージョン いくつかのニュースで到着します そして何よりも、さまざまなデバイスのサポートが強化されています。 目立つ主な変更点は、Linuxカーネル5.4以降のサポートです。
コントローラー さまざまなオペレーティングシステムとプラットフォームで利用できるようになりました。 Linux(ARM、x86_64)、FreeBSD(x86_64)、およびSolaris(x86_64)。 この新しいバージョン Nvidiaドライバー 長いサポートサイクルの新しいバージョンの一部として開発されます (LTS)2020年XNUMX月まで。
NVIDIA 440.31ドライバーの新機能は何ですか?
Nvidia 440.31ドライバーのこの新しい安定したブランチのリリースに伴い、Linuxに登場する主なノベルティのXNUMXつです。 Linux Kernel5.4を使用したモジュールのコンパイルが整理されていることがわかります。 現像。
X11の場合、新しいオプションが導入されました «サイドバンドソケットパス«、XドライバーがUNIXソケットを作成するディレクトリを指します コンポーネントと対話する OpenGL、Vulkan、VDPAU Nvidiaドライバー。
デフォルトでは、 オプション «ハードDPMS» X11構成で有効になっている、VESA DPMSで提供されていないディスプレイモードを使用しているときに、ディスプレイをスリープモードにすることができます(オプションn一部のモニターをスリープモードにできないという問題を解決します DPMSがアクティブな場合)。
また 保存されていない変更の存在に関する警告も追加されました 確認ダイアログの設定でユーティリティを終了します nvidia-設定。
へ HDMI 2.1、リフレッシュレートのサポートが追加されました 可変画面(VRRG-SYNC)、 と同様 拡張機能のサポートも追加されました OpenGLGLX_NV_multigpu_contextおよびGL_NV_gpu_multicast。
すべてのビデオメモリがいっぱいになる状況で、一部のコントローラ操作をシステムメモリ使用量に戻す機能が実装されました。 この変更により、空きビデオメモリがない場合にVulkanアプリケーションで発生するXid13およびXid31エラーを取り除くことができます。
その他の変更点 広告で目立つもの:
- 他のGPUへのレンダリング操作の転送を提供するPRIMEテクノロジーのEGLサポートが追加されました(PRIME Render Offload)。
- VDPAUドライバーは、VP9形式のビデオのデコードのサポートを追加しました。
- GPUタイマー制御戦略が変更されました。GPUの負荷が減少すると、タイマー割り込みを生成する頻度が減少します。
- SUPER GeForce GTX 1660GPUのサポートが追加されました。
Ubuntuおよび派生物にNVIDIA440.31ドライバーをインストールするにはどうすればよいですか?
このドライバーをインストールするには、 次のリンクへ ダウンロードします。
注:プロセスを実行する前に、この新しいドライバーとコンピューターの構成(システム、カーネル、Linuxヘッダー、Xorgバージョン)との互換性を確認することが重要です。そうでない場合は、最終的に発生する可能性があります。黒い画面で、それを行うかどうかはあなたの決定であるため、私たちはいつでもそれに対して責任を負いません。
ダウンロード中 nouveauの無料ドライバーとの競合を避けるために、ブラックリストの作成に進みましょう。
sudo nano /etc/modprobe.d/blacklist-nouveau.conf
そして、その中に以下を追加します。
blacklist nouveau blacklist lbm-nouveau options nouveau modeset=0 alias nouveau off alias lbm-nouveau off
これが完了したら、システムを再起動して、ブラックリストを有効にします。
システムが再起動されたら、次のコマンドでグラフィカルサーバー(グラフィカルインターフェイス)を停止します。
sudo init 3
起動時に黒い画面が表示された場合、またはグラフィカルサーバーを停止した場合は、次のキー構成「Ctrl + Alt + F1」を入力してTTYにアクセスします。
以前のバージョンを既にお持ちの場合は、 競合の可能性を回避するために、アンインストールを実行することをお勧めします。
次のコマンドを実行するだけです。
sudo apt-get purge nvidia *
そして今がインストールを実行する時です。このために、次のコマンドで実行権限を付与します。
sudo chmod +x NVIDIA-Linux*.run
そして、次のように実行します。
sh NVIDIA-Linux-*.run
インストールの最後に、コンピュータを再起動するだけで、起動時にすべての変更が読み込まれます。